Kazakhstan is home to a significant 고려인 (Koryo-saram) ethnic Korean community, making it one of the key countries for F-4 Overseas Korean and H-2 Working Visit visa applicants. Kazakhstan is also an EPS partner country, and Kazakh IT and engineering professionals are increasingly present in Korea's tech sector.

Visa required — C-3 needed for short-term visits
Kazakh passport holders are not eligible for visa-free entry to Korea. A C-3 tourist visa is required. Ethnic Koreans may apply for C-3-8 simplified processing.

Do Kazakh 고려인 qualify for F-4 and H-2?
Yes. 고려인 from Kazakhstan are recognized as overseas Koreans under Korean law (재외동포법). Proof of Korean ancestry is required — typically a 출생증명서 (birth certificate) and 가족관계 확인 서류 (family relationship documents) tracing your lineage to Korean-born ancestors. The documents should be officially translated into Korean and apostilled or authenticated.
What sectors are open to Kazakh EPS E-9 workers?
Manufacturing, construction, agriculture, fisheries, and service sectors approved under the EPS system. Kazakhstan is particularly active in manufacturing sector placement.
Are there Korean language resources for 고려인 in Kazakhstan?
Yes. Korean cultural centres (한국문화원) and Korean language education programmes are available in Almaty and Astana. KIIP (Korea Immigration Integration Programme) preparatory courses are available online and help with both language and the KIIP aptitude test required for F-2-99 and F-5.
